At Alignerr, we partner with the world’s leading AI research teams and labs to build and train cutting‑edge AI models. We are seeking an Oncology Clinical Researcher to bring deep expertise in cancer clinical trials into AI‑driven research and evaluation workflows. In this role, you will ensure that oncology trial data used to train and assess advanced AI systems reflects real‑world regulatory, scientific, and clinical standards.

Location: Remote | Commitment: 10–40 hours/week

What You’ll Do:

  • Design and run oncology clinical trials by developing study protocols, overseeing patient enrollment, and ensuring compliance with regulatory and ethical standards.
  • Analyze cancer trial data, including safety, efficacy, and biomarker results, to evaluate how well treatments perform.
  • Translate trial outcomes into regulatory and scientific reports used for FDA/EMA submissions, publications, and clinical decision‑making.
  • Review and evaluate AI‑generated clinical insights for accuracy, clinical relevance, and regulatory alignment.

What We’re Looking For:

  • Experience designing and managing oncology clinical trials from protocol development through data readout.
  • Strong background in analyzing oncology clinical data, including endpoints, safety profiles, and biomarkers.
  • Familiarity with regulatory submission standards for agencies such as the FDA or EMA.
  • Prior experience with data annotation, data quality, or evaluation systems.
